A corrosion-resistant free-machining brass alloy, its preparation method and application
By adding elements such as Si, Ni, and Mn to brass alloys to form a composite κ phase, the environmental protection and performance deficiencies of brass alloy materials are solved, achieving excellent machinability, corrosion resistance, and mechanical properties, making it suitable for a variety of industrial applications.

AI Technical Summary
Existing brass alloy materials suffer from problems such as toxicity and lack of environmental friendliness, insufficient machinability, corrosion resistance, or mechanical properties, making it difficult to meet environmental protection requirements and the needs of high-performance application scenarios.
By adding elements such as Si, Ni, and Mn and controlling the content of each element, a composite κ phase (Cu, Ni, Mn)5ZnSi is formed, which synergistically improves the machinability, corrosion resistance, and mechanical properties of the alloy and optimizes the microstructure of the alloy.
It achieves a comprehensive balance of alloy properties, possesses excellent machinability, corrosion resistance, and mechanical properties, meets environmental protection requirements, and is suitable for a variety of industrial applications.
